If you believe that you don’t have the money for hiring a personal injury attorney, determine whether they’ll work for you on a contingency basis. A contingency basically means that you don’t have to pay anything unless your case is won. This means that you don’t have to pay out of your savings for the legal help, and the lawyer will be that much more motivated to get a good settlement for you.
